Originally Posted by Rusted_nailz,Jul 11 2007, 11:15 PM
Ive had the K&N FIPK and although it sounded nice and had the heat shield, it would cause heat bog on a hot day. I switch to the spoon style snorkle along with a K&N filter and am completely happy with it. No heat bog and notice much better throttle response, especially at highway speeds.
I've experienced the opposite, I have the FIPK and it eliminated any heat bog that the stock airbox caused. But this is paired with the AUT cooling plate... with both the airbox and FIPK.
